The Faculty of Agriculture and Veterinary Medicine’s Department of Nutrition and Food Technology at An-Najah National University in cooperation with Palestine Standards Institution (PSI) of the Ministry of National Economy and the Palestinian Society for Consumer Protection, organized a workshop titled: "Food Quality and Safety".


The workshop was attended by Dr. Heba Al-Fares, Dean of the Faculty of Agriculture and Veterinary Medicine, Mr. Muhammad Dalaq from PSI and Dr. Samer Mudallal, Lecturer in the Department of Nutrition and Food Technology at the University.

It provided the participants with the necessary framework for the design and implementation of effective food safety and quality systems. It included a discussion about ensuring safe food production in compliance with regulatory and global food safety and quality management system standards.

“Food safety is about consumers safety, and food quality is about consumers’ satisfaction. Both concepts require stringent practices on the food supply chain in order to preserve food from contamination, food-borne illness or other type of adulteration that would affect the final safety and quality of the food product”. Mr. Dalaq said.

Dr. Mudallal talked about mycotoxin levels in food in the Palestinian market, and referred to a number of research studies that have been implemented regarding food quality and safety in the Palestinian market.
